Types of Ovens
When looking for an oven, particularly around sales occasions, it's necessary to know which type suits your cooking design and kitchen layout. Below are the most typical types of ovens on the market:
Oven TypeDescriptionPerfect ForTraditional OvensThese ovens utilize either gas or electric heating components for cooking.General baking and cooking.Convection OvensEquipped with a fan that circulates hot air for even cooking.Baking several trays at the same time.Wall OvensSet up in the wall, releasing up space in the kitchen counters.Small kitchen areas with minimal area.Double OvensConsists of two separate oven cavities, permitting for multi-tasking.Big households or those who entertain frequently.Variety OvensIntegrates a cooktop and an oven in one unit.Those needing both stovetop and oven.Portable OvensSmaller, often electric, ovens appropriate for restricted spaces or outdoors.Dormitories, small houses, or outdoor camping.Key Features to Consider
When searching for an oven on sale, certain features can significantly affect your cooking experience. Buyers ought to focus on the following:

Size: Ensure the oven fits your kitchen area. Step the location where the oven will be installed before making a purchase.

Fuel Type: Decide between gas and electric. Gas ovens provide precise temperature control, while electric ovens tend to be more constant in baking.

Self-Cleaning: Self-cleaning ovens conserve time and effort in preserving cleanliness, a necessary feature for hectic families.

Smart Features: Modern ovens may consist of Wi-Fi connectivity, enabling you to control your oven On sales remotely, change settings, and receive notices.

Temperature level Range: Consider the adaptability of temperature level settings. High-end models frequently offer a broader series of temperature levels for various cooking designs.

Extra Cooking Modes: Some ovens feature specialized modes like steam, broil, and air fry, offering versatility in cooking methods.

How do I understand if the oven is energy-efficient?
Energy Star-rated ovens normally represent much better energy efficiency. Look for the Energy Guide label on the device, which offers yearly energy intake information.
